Rev 2287 | Go to most recent revision | Show entire file | Regard whitespace | Details | Blame | Last modification | View Log | RSS feed
Rev 2287 | Rev 2298 | ||
---|---|---|---|
Line 99... | Line 99... | ||
99 | jne @f |
99 | jne @f |
100 | mcall -1 ;exit if not open box_lib.obj |
100 | mcall -1 ;exit if not open box_lib.obj |
101 | @@: |
101 | @@: |
102 | mcall 40,0x27 ;¬ ᪠á¨á⥬ëå ᮡë⨩ |
102 | mcall 40,0x27 ;¬ ᪠á¨á⥬ëå ᮡë⨩ |
103 | ;--------------------------------------------------------------------- |
103 | ;--------------------------------------------------------------------- |
- | 104 | init_checkboxes2 ch1_dbg,ch1_dbg+ch_struc_size |
|
104 | get_sys_colors 1,0 |
105 | get_sys_colors 1,0 |
105 | edit_boxes_set_sys_color edit1,editboxes_end,sc |
106 | edit_boxes_set_sys_color edit1,editboxes_end,sc |
106 | check_boxes_set_sys_color ch1_dbg,ch1_dbg+ch_struc_size,sc |
107 | check_boxes_set_sys_color2 ch1_dbg,ch1_dbg+ch_struc_size,sc |
107 | ;--------------------------------------------------------------------- |
108 | ;--------------------------------------------------------------------- |
108 | ; OpenDialog initialisation |
109 | ; OpenDialog initialisation |
109 | push dword OpenDialog_data |
110 | push dword OpenDialog_data |
110 | call dword [OpenDialog_Init] |
111 | call dword [OpenDialog_Init] |
111 | ;--------------------------------------------------------------------- |
112 | ;--------------------------------------------------------------------- |
Line 405... | Line 406... | ||
405 | 406 | ||
406 | s_compile db '®¬¯¨«.' |
407 | s_compile db '®¬¯¨«.' |
407 | s_run db ' ã᪠' |
408 | s_run db ' ã᪠' |
408 | s_debug db 'â« ¤ª ' |
409 | s_debug db 'â« ¤ª ' |
409 | s_dbgdescr db '®§¤ ¢ âì ®â« ¤®çãî ¨ä®à¬ æ¨î',0 |
- | |
- | 410 | s_dbgdescr db '®§¤ ¢ âì ®â« ¤®çãî ¨ä®à¬ æ¨î',0 |
|
Line 410... | Line 411... | ||
410 | s_dbgdescr_end: |
411 | |
411 | 412 | ||
412 | err_message_found_lib0 db '¥ ©¤¥ ¡¨¡«¨®â¥ª box_lib.obj',0 ;áâப , ª®â®à ï ¡ã¤¥â ¢ áä®à¬¨à®¢ ®¬ ®ª¥, ¥á«¨ ¡¨¡«¨®â¥ª ¥ ¡ã¤¥â ©¤¥ |
413 | err_message_found_lib0 db '¥ ©¤¥ ¡¨¡«¨®â¥ª box_lib.obj',0 ;áâப , ª®â®à ï ¡ã¤¥â ¢ áä®à¬¨à®¢ ®¬ ®ª¥, ¥á«¨ ¡¨¡«¨®â¥ª ¥ ¡ã¤¥â ©¤¥ |
413 | err_message_import0 db '訡ª ¯à¨ ¨¬¯®à⥠¡¨¡«¨®â¥ª¨ box_lib.obj',0 |
414 | err_message_import0 db '訡ª ¯à¨ ¨¬¯®à⥠¡¨¡«¨®â¥ª¨ box_lib.obj',0 |
Line 425... | Line 426... | ||
425 | 426 | ||
426 | s_compile db 'COMPILE' |
427 | s_compile db 'COMPILE' |
427 | s_run db ' RUN ' |
428 | s_run db ' RUN ' |
428 | s_debug db ' DEBUG ' |
429 | s_debug db ' DEBUG ' |
429 | s_dbgdescr db 'Generate debug information',0 |
- | |
- | 430 | s_dbgdescr db 'Generate debug information',0 |
|
Line 430... | Line 431... | ||
430 | s_dbgdescr_end: |
431 | |
431 | 432 | ||
432 | err_message_found_lib0 db 'Sorry I cannot found library box_lib.obj',0 |
433 | err_message_found_lib0 db 'Sorry I cannot found library box_lib.obj',0 |
433 | err_message_import0 db 'Error on load import library box_lib.obj',0 |
434 | err_message_import0 db 'Error on load import library box_lib.obj',0 |
Line 450... | Line 451... | ||
450 | edit_box_key dd aEdit_box_key |
451 | edit_box_key dd aEdit_box_key |
451 | edit_box_mouse dd aEdit_box_mouse |
452 | edit_box_mouse dd aEdit_box_mouse |
452 | edit_box_set_text dd aEdit_box_set_text |
453 | edit_box_set_text dd aEdit_box_set_text |
453 | ;version_ed dd aVersion_ed |
454 | ;version_ed dd aVersion_ed |
Line -... | Line 455... | ||
- | 455 | ||
454 | 456 | init_checkbox dd aInit_checkbox |
|
455 | check_box_draw dd aCheck_box_draw |
457 | check_box_draw dd aCheck_box_draw |
456 | check_box_mouse dd aCheck_box_mouse |
458 | check_box_mouse dd aCheck_box_mouse |
Line 457... | Line 459... | ||
457 | ;version_ch dd aVersion_ch |
459 | ;version_ch dd aVersion_ch |
Line 462... | Line 464... | ||
462 | aEdit_box_key db 'edit_box_key',0 |
464 | aEdit_box_key db 'edit_box_key',0 |
463 | aEdit_box_mouse db 'edit_box_mouse',0 |
465 | aEdit_box_mouse db 'edit_box_mouse',0 |
464 | aEdit_box_set_text db 'edit_box_set_text',0 |
466 | aEdit_box_set_text db 'edit_box_set_text',0 |
465 | ;aVersion_ed db 'version_ed',0 |
467 | ;aVersion_ed db 'version_ed',0 |
Line -... | Line 468... | ||
- | 468 | ||
466 | 469 | aInit_checkbox db 'init_checkbox2',0 |
|
467 | aCheck_box_draw db 'check_box_draw',0 |
470 | aCheck_box_draw db 'check_box_draw2',0 |
468 | aCheck_box_mouse db 'check_box_mouse',0 |
471 | aCheck_box_mouse db 'check_box_mouse2',0 |
469 | ;aVersion_ch db 'version_ch',0 |
472 | ;aVersion_ch db 'version_ch2',0 |
470 | ;--------------------------------------------------------------------- |
473 | ;--------------------------------------------------------------------- |
471 | align 4 |
474 | align 4 |
472 | import_proc_lib: |
475 | import_proc_lib: |
473 | OpenDialog_Init dd aOpenDialog_Init |
476 | OpenDialog_Init dd aOpenDialog_Init |
Line 484... | Line 487... | ||
484 | 487 | ||
485 | edit1 edit_box 153, 56, 1, 0xffffff, 0xff, 0x80ff, 0, 0x8000, (outfile-infile-1), infile, mouse_dd, 0, 11,11 |
488 | edit1 edit_box 153, 56, 1, 0xffffff, 0xff, 0x80ff, 0, 0x8000, (outfile-infile-1), infile, mouse_dd, 0, 11,11 |
486 | edit2 edit_box 153, 56, 17, 0xffffff, 0xff, 0x80ff, 0, 0x8000,(path-outfile-1), outfile, mouse_dd, 0, 7,7 |
489 | edit2 edit_box 153, 56, 17, 0xffffff, 0xff, 0x80ff, 0, 0x8000,(path-outfile-1), outfile, mouse_dd, 0, 7,7 |
487 | edit3 edit_box 153, 56, 33, 0xffffff, 0xff, 0x80ff, 0, 0x8000,(path_end-path-1), path, mouse_dd, 0, 6,6 |
490 | edit3 edit_box 153, 56, 33, 0xffffff, 0xff, 0x80ff, 0, 0x8000,(path_end-path-1), path, mouse_dd, 0, 6,6 |
488 | editboxes_end: |
491 | editboxes_end: |
489 | ch1_dbg check_box 5, 49, 6, 12, 0xffffff, 0x80ff, 0, s_dbgdescr,(s_dbgdescr_end-s_dbgdescr) |
492 | ch1_dbg check_box2 (5 shl 16)+12, (49 shl 16)+12, 6, 0xffffff, 0x80ff, 0, s_dbgdescr,ch_flag_bottom |
490 | ;--------------------------------------------------------------------- |
493 | ;--------------------------------------------------------------------- |
491 | align 4 |
494 | align 4 |
492 | OpenDialog_data: |
495 | OpenDialog_data: |
493 | .type dd 0 |
496 | .type dd 0 |